90 Day Fiance star Larissa Christina Dos Santos Lima has escaped the domestic battery charge from her November fight with Colt Johnson.

According to court documents, Larissa will no longer face charges stemming from her November arrest because the Clark County District Attorney rejected the case, E! News reported.

Larissa was arrested for domestic violence last month after a fight with Colt in their home.

The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department received a call about Larissa claiming on Instagram she had been "locked" in the bathroom while Colt was "going crazy," according to the police report obtained by In Touch Weekly.

When police arrived at Colt and Larissa's home, "yelling" between a male and female allegedly "became increasingly loud" and, due to sounds of "distress," an officer attempted to kick the door down.

Larissa, however, reportedly opened the front door and then ran outside, prompting police to place Colt in handcuffs.

The couple told authorities their dispute was over Colt cutting off Larissa's cell phone service, according to In Touch.

Colt alleged Larissa had "pushed" him against a wall and scratched his left eye "with her fingernail." He could also reportedly prove there was a red bruise on the right side of his stomach.

Larissa, on the other hand, showed no signs of physical violence on Colt's part, although she reportedly insisted he had "pulled the back of her hair."

Following the incident, Colt revealed in an Instagram Story, "The police interviewed us but not long after they decided to arrest Larissa," E! News reported.

"No one was hurt and I did not press charges against my wife. However it is policy in the state of Nevada that since we are in a domestic partnership, someone had to be arrested."

Colt claimed Larissa was dealing with the effects of her severe anxiety and depression at the time, but Larissa later denied being depressed in a since-deleted Instagram post. She had also insisted in the post, however, "nobody was scratched or hurt" during the altercation.

Now that the charges are dropped, Larissa has thanked her friends and family for their support and reportedly wrote in an Instagram Story, "The law is hard but the law is the law."

Larissa and Colt currently star on Season 6 of 90 Day Fiance on TLC and their relationship has proved to be very tumultuous. One minute, they are happily engaged, and the next, Larissa is throwing her diamond engagement ring on the ground and threatening to end their relationship.
